Multi-Tech's products use a 10-pin 10Base-T connector. Some manufacturers use an 8-pin
format. This format is compatible with the EN301CT16d, and will plug in and work without
modification. If an 8-pin RJ-45 is used with the EN301CT16c, use the pin assignments
shown in the 8-pin column.
